This commit is contained in:
parent
532386222b
commit
1e331cada5
1 changed files with 3 additions and 8 deletions
|
|
@ -21,7 +21,7 @@ type Deps struct {
|
||||||
const pkgLogHeader string = "Router |"
|
const pkgLogHeader string = "Router |"
|
||||||
|
|
||||||
func NewHandler(deps Deps) *Handler {
|
func NewHandler(deps Deps) *Handler {
|
||||||
engine := gin.Default()
|
engine := gin.New()
|
||||||
|
|
||||||
if deps.GinMode == "release" {
|
if deps.GinMode == "release" {
|
||||||
gin.SetMode(gin.ReleaseMode)
|
gin.SetMode(gin.ReleaseMode)
|
||||||
|
|
@ -32,17 +32,12 @@ func NewHandler(deps Deps) *Handler {
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
engine.GET("/", func(c *gin.Context) { c.JSON(200, gin.H{"msg": "v2"}) })
|
logGroup := engine.Group("")
|
||||||
|
logGroup.GET("/", func(c *gin.Context) { c.JSON(200, gin.H{"msg": "v2"}) })
|
||||||
|
|
||||||
p := ginprometheus.NewPrometheus("gin")
|
p := ginprometheus.NewPrometheus("gin")
|
||||||
p.Use(engine)
|
p.Use(engine)
|
||||||
|
|
||||||
engine.Use(gin.LoggerWithConfig(gin.LoggerConfig{
|
|
||||||
Skip: func(c *gin.Context) bool {
|
|
||||||
return c.Request.URL.Path == "/metrics"
|
|
||||||
},
|
|
||||||
}))
|
|
||||||
|
|
||||||
srv := http.Server{
|
srv := http.Server{
|
||||||
Addr: deps.Addr,
|
Addr: deps.Addr,
|
||||||
Handler: engine,
|
Handler: engine,
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ue